After 1.5 Years, I Feel Like the Developers Are Losing Touch With Reality

75 Upvotes

So, what can I say about Tacticus after playing it for a year and a half?

First of all, it is genuinely a fun and addictive game, especially in the beginning. The Warhammer 40,000 universe is incredibly interesting and almost limitless, and Tacticus was actually the game that introduced me to it. I was a complete newcomer and had never really paid attention to Warhammer before, so I have to give the game credit for that.

But, as always, there is a "but."

When I started playing, the monetization and pay-to-win elements didn't bother me that much. Spending €10 or €20 here and there to unlock a character you really wanted a little faster seemed reasonable enough. More importantly, you still had the feeling that almost everything could eventually be achieved through persistence, effort, and time.

Unfortunately, with the recent changes, it increasingly feels like the developers are losing touch with reality, and their greed is becoming harder and harder to ignore.

The biggest problem is that monetization is no longer just about speeding up your personal progress or getting a character earlier. It is increasingly becoming something you are pushed into simply to participate comfortably and effectively in an alliance.

And alliances, in my opinion, are one of the biggest reasons people stay in this game.

The social aspect of Tacticus may actually be its greatest strength. Yes, seriously. A lot of us are not playing only because we want another legendary character or a slightly bigger number on the screen. We play because of the people we have met. We talk, joke around, make friends, compete together, help each other, and work toward common goals. They may only be goals in a mobile game, but achieving something together still brings people closer.

And this is exactly why the recent direction of the game feels so wrong.

With the latest updates, some alliance goals are effectively becoming achievable only through spending real money.

That is incredibly disappointing.

At this point, I am genuinely starting to wonder whether I have had enough. It increasingly feels like the developers have looked at the social bonds players have built and realized that those relationships themselves can be monetized:

"You have a lot of people in your alliance. You've become friends. You're ambitious and want to achieve something together? Well, then pay us for it."

That is where I draw the line.

Monetizing convenience is one thing. Monetizing faster progression is something I can tolerate. Even selling characters is understandable in a free-to-play mobile game.

But deliberately putting alliance goals behind increasingly aggressive monetization and exploiting the fact that players don't want to let their teammates down is something else entirely.

It feels manipulative, greedy, and honestly disgusting.

I really like Tacticus, and I am grateful that it introduced me to the Warhammer universe. But if this direction doesn't change soon, I think I will follow Nandi's example and leave the game.

There is a point where supporting a game turns into rewarding its developers for treating their community like a wallet.

For me, Tacticus is getting dangerously close to that point.
